Engine Tuning Enhancements
Engine tuning modifications play a key role in maximizing a vehicle's speed and performance. By fine-tuning engine parameters, such as fuel-air mixture and ignition timing, these changes can significantly improve power output and torque. Performance chips and engine management systems allow for exact adjustments, enabling drivers to unlock their vehicle's capability. Upgrading to high-performance exhaust systems enhances airflow, reducing back pressure and boosting engine efficiency. Additionally, aftermarket intakes raise the amount of air entering the engine, supporting better combustion. Together, these modifications lead to faster acceleration and improved throttle response. For enthusiasts seeking to boost their driving experience, investing in engine tuning parts is a vital step toward reaching peak speed and reliability on the road.

Suspension Enhancements for Enhanced Handling
Suspension enhancements constitute an vital part of boosting a vehicle's driving dynamics, as they directly shape how the car responds to the road. These modifications boost stability, responsiveness, and ride quality. By swapping out factory components with advanced suspension components, drivers can realize improved turning performance, less body roll, and better traction.
Reinforced stabilizer bars strengthen transverse rigidity, making possible superior handling in turns. Coilover assemblies furnish adjustable ride height and damping control, empowering drivers to fine-tune their vehicle's stance and handling characteristics. In addition, high-performance bushings are able to cut flex and boost feedback from the road, creating a more connected driving experience.
Making investments in suspension improvements not only strengthens performance but also strengthens overall safety by providing better control in multiple driving conditions. Ultimately, these enhancements allow drivers to fully utilize their vehicle's potential, making them an important factor for those in pursuit of superior handling.

Compatibility With Vehicle
Grasping vehicle compatibility is vital in the pursuit for performance upgrades. Every car features distinct design parameters, such as engine type, suspension layout, and electronic systems, which affect the suitability of aftermarket parts. Drivers need to account for aspects like make, model, and year to guarantee that parts fit properly and perform optimally. Furthermore, compatibility between performance parts and existing systems is vital; for instance, an upgraded exhaust system must comply with the vehicle's emissions standards. Neglecting these factors can result in suboptimal performance or even cause damage. Therefore, thorough research and advice from experts are essential in choosing performance parts that boost rather than diminish vehicle functionality and reliability.
Professional Installation against DIY: Which Is Most Suitable for You?
What is the way to figure out whether expert fitting or a DIY approach is the better choice for auto performance parts? This selection often depends upon a variety of factors, including the complexity of the installation, the user’s mechanical capability, and the possibility for warranty implications. Professional installation usually guarantees parts are properly fitted, leveraging the expertise of trained technicians who can address any unforeseen issues. This route is preferable for advanced modifications, where precision is important to performance and safety.
On the other hand, a do-it-yourself approach appeals to those with a solid understanding of car mechanics and a wish to reduce on labor costs. It can also provide a feeling of satisfaction. However, people must honestly assess their skills and the tools required for the task. Ultimately, the choice between professional installation and do-it-yourself depends on personal capability, confidence, and the particular requirements of the performance parts involved.
